Recognizing the Classic Automobile Market
To understand the classic automobile market, you should familiarize yourself with the one-of-a-kind variables that influence its worth and demand.
One of the primary factors that affects the value of a vintage car is its problem. Automobiles that are properly maintained and in good working order often tend to have greater values than those that are in inadequate problem.
An additional factor to think about is the rarity of the car. If a specific design is uncommon and hard to locate, it will likely have a greater need and for that reason a higher worth.

Investigating the Lorry's Background
Before you purchase or sell a classic car, it's crucial to thoroughly investigate the vehicle's history. Researching the background of a vintage car entails gathering information about its previous proprietors, maintenance records, and any kind of accidents or damages it might have experienced.
Beginning by inspecting the lorry identification number (VIN) to accessibility essential details such as the vehicle's production beginning, year, and version. You can also utilize on the internet data sources and resources to search for any reported accidents or title concerns associated with the automobile.
Additionally, it's vital to analyze the auto's service records to make sure regular upkeep and identify any kind of possible mechanical concerns.
Checking for Potential Issues
One essential action in the vintage car acquiring or marketing procedure is to thoroughly examine the automobile for any kind of prospective issues or problems. When checking GPS Tracking for Collector Cars , focus on both the outside and interior.
Beginning by examining the bodywork for rust, damages, or any signs of previous accidents. Check the paint high quality, making certain it's consistent and devoid of any kind of scratches or bubbles. Take a close take a look at the tires, ensuring they've enough walk and are in good condition.
Inside the auto, inspect the upholstery for any type of rips or stains. Test the lights, signs, and all electrical components to guarantee they're in working order. Finally, it's essential to evaluate the engine, transmission, and other mechanical components to identify any kind of prospective problems.
Taking the time to extensively inspect the vintage car can assist you stay clear of pricey shocks down the road.
